Cagliari Court implements official dress code regulation
The Court of Cagliari has implemented an official dress code regulation for all individuals entering the Palace of Justice, including visitors, staff, and magistrates. The directive, approved by the permanent conference, aims to restore decorum to judicial offices and ensure respect for the institution.
Prohibited items include miniskirts, shorts, beach slippers, tank tops, sleeveless garments, transparent clothing, and hats. Security personnel stationed at entry points will be responsible for enforcing these rules. While some legal professionals noted that judges and lawyers already wear robes during hearings, others argued that written rules are necessary when civic sense fails to maintain the sanctity of the judicial environment.
